Introducing the 2026 Board Appointees

Jul 1, 2026

The life saving, life changing shelter and services that we provide to adults experiencing homelessness in our community would not be possible without the hundreds of volunteers who give of their time, talent and treasure, including our volunteer Board members.           

We are delighted to welcome four new members to the Emergency Shelter of Northern Kentucky Board of Directors:

Taraneh Amoozegar joins the Board in the role of Treasurer and Finance Chair. She is a senior accounting professional at Givaudan, specializing in financial reporting and accounting operations.

Many of you know Taraneh as a longtime volunteer at ESNKY. She has also served on our Finance Committee, and we are delighted to welcome her to the Board in this new role. A graduate of the University of Cincinnati, Taraneh believes safe shelter is a basic human right and is committed to strengthening housing stability and improving access to essential needs across our community.

 

Greta Elenbaas joins the Board as a member-at-large. She is a risk management director at Service Center Principal Financial Group and brings more than two decades of experience in financial services and risk management.

A graduate of Albion College and the University of Chicago, Greta’s involvement with ESNKY dates back to when we were still located on Scott Street and she first visited as part of the Northern Kentucky Chamber of Commerce’s Leadership NKY program. Greta not only volunteers at shelter, but for the past three years has helped organize our major fundraisers as a member of the Homeless to Hopeful Gala Committee.

 

Sheila Oeder joins the Board as a member-at-large. She is a senior vice president in Workplace Investing Relationship Management at Fidelity Investments, leading a global team of over 200 associates and supporting more than 13,000 clients. She brings nearly 30 years of financial services expertise to the board.

Sheila also brings a passion for service, strategic leadership, and a commitment to strengthening our community: last year, she served on the ESNKY Governance Committee. Her prior nonprofit and leadership contributions include board service with Dress for Success Cincinnati and being a founder of Fidelity’s regional women’s leadership group.

Sheila holds a bachelor’s degree in Economics and Human & Organizational Development from Vanderbilt University and a master’s degree in Applied Economics from the University of Cincinnati.

 

Maddie Sheets joins the Board as a member-at-large. Madison is an accounting professional with a background in financial auditing and a passion for serving her communities. A graduate of the University of Dayton, where she earned a bachelor's and master's degree in accounting, she has held numerous leadership roles focused on financial stewardship, mentorship, and collaboration.

Madison is proud to serve on the Board of Directors for Emergency Shelter of Northern Kentucky, where she is committed to supporting the organization's mission and helping create pathways to stability for neighbors experiencing homelessness.

 

Additionally, Tricia Watts is departing the Board after several years of dedicated service:

Tricia currently serves as the Executive Director for WAVE Foundation, the nonprofit partner of the Newport Aquarium. Tricia has always brought a growth mindset and a wealth of non-profit knowledge to her time at ESNKY. She has been volunteering since she was a child in her hometown of Hazard, KY and her first involvement at ESNKY began with serving meals and doing laundry at the former Scott Street location. She has since served on the ESNKY Board of Directors as Communications Committee Chair, Vice Chair, Chair and Past Chair. She will remain a tireless advocate for our neighbors experiencing homelessness and a meals volunteer, bringing her love of cooking to the ESNKY guests.

Please join us in thanking Tricia for her leadership, vision and dedication and welcoming these talented women to the Board!
